 Flight of Folly 2009-01-31 . chapter 4Chapter 2: You’re in your element when writing about the parent-child relationship… I loved Jack and Jackie’s (never understand why parents name kids after themselves, it’s just plain confusing) growing affection.
However, the scene with Kim was a little overdramatic and felt rushed. I think this scene would benefit from a longer development of their renewed relationship. And while I loved the whole shock-value approach to Kim meeting Jackie, Kim’s reaction- especially once alone again with her father- seemed a bit cheesy and over accepting given what we have previously seen of the Jack-Kim relationship.
I also felt that the scene with Bill did very little to further the story… he was just a very overqualified courier.
Chapter 3: I really liked the integrated flash-backs of Jack and Audrey’s experiences in the prison camp; they not only filled in some blanks but helped to grasp the challenges of returning to a normal life.
Given that Heller has a current restraining order for Jack, I thought his reaction to the whole interrupted embrace was a little ‘too much talk, not enough action’. If he really believed that Jack was taking advantage of his daughter, he wouldn’t just cast aspersions he’d either lay down the law or evict Jack.
Chapter 4: There were a couple of great scenes in this chapter, in particular the manipulative plotting of Jack as he had Jackie take Audrey her drink, and then of Jackie as she claimed the juiciest strawberry. I also liked the role reversal where Jackie got to look after her mother when she awoke from her nightmare- and what a nightmare at that!
The whole stuffed koala as a security blanket, and Audrey’s journey down the stairs to the beach, also made for some interesting psychoanalysis.
Overall, this was an enjoyable story… and happy endings- no matter how clique or predictable- are always welcome, especially when they are well-written.
